Protocol over UART for Real-Time Applications

被引:2
|
作者
Daraban, Mihai [1 ]
Corches, Cosmina [2 ]
Taut, Adrian [1 ]
Chindris, Gabriel [1 ]
机构
[1] Tech Univ Cluj Napoca, Appl Elect Dept, Cluj Napoca, Romania
[2] Tech Univ Cluj Napoca, Automat Dept, Cluj Napoca, Romania
关键词
UART; real-time; framing; protocol; embedded;
D O I
10.1109/SIITME53254.2021.9663605
中图分类号
TM [电工技术]; TN [电子技术、通信技术];
学科分类号
0808 ; 0809 ;
摘要
Nowadays, high-speed interfaces are used for data transfer between Internet of Things (IoT) devices or different wearable devices. However, embedded microcontrollers are still equipped with low-speed interfaces as universal asynchronous receiver/transmitter (UART), serial peripheral interface (SPI) or inter-integrated circuit (I2C). These interfaces provide the physical layer for sending or receiving sensor data. The main advantages being the low power associated for driving the interfaces and the low price for having them as integrated peripheral in the microcontroller. Besides being a local communication interface, UART can also be used for inter-device communication (e.g. device status, sending erroneous messages, performing software update). In the previous scenarios, UART data transmission is not safe and can be prone to errors. The paper presents a framing that improves UART communication for real-time embedded devices. Beside the message frame also a message handle service is implemented such that the communication process does not interfere with the device's real-time operation.
引用
收藏
页码:85 / 88
页数:4
相关论文
共 50 条
  • [1] A real-time VLC to UART protocol conversion system
    邓健志
    姚萌
    程小辉
    邓卓洪
    [J]. Optoelectronics Letters, 2016, 12 (04) : 299 - 303
  • [2] A real-time VLC to UART protocol conversion system
    Deng J.-Z.
    Yao M.
    Cheng X.-H.
    Deng Z.-H.
    [J]. Optoelectronics Letters, 2016, 12 (4) : 299 - 303
  • [3] Protocol synthesis for real-time applications
    Khoumsi, A
    Bochmann, GV
    Dssouli, R
    [J]. FORMAL METHODS FOR PROTOCOL ENGINEERING AND DISTRIBUTED SYSTEMS, 1999, 28 : 417 - 433
  • [4] An efficient negotiation protocol for real-time multimedia applications over wireless networks
    Wang, XB
    Wang, WY
    [J]. 2004 IEEE WIRELESS COMMUNICATIONS AND NETWORKING CONFERENCE, VOLS 1-4: BROADBAND WIRELESS - THE TIME IS NOW, 2004, : 2533 - 2538
  • [5] Cooperative flow regulation protocol for real-time and non-real-time applications over satellite network
    J. Govindarajan
    G. Kousalya
    [J]. Journal of Ambient Intelligence and Humanized Computing, 2021, 12 : 979 - 990
  • [6] Cooperative flow regulation protocol for real-time and non-real-time applications over satellite network
    Govindarajan, J.
    Kousalya, G.
    [J]. JOURNAL OF AMBIENT INTELLIGENCE AND HUMANIZED COMPUTING, 2021, 12 (01) : 979 - 990
  • [7] RAP - A REAL-TIME ADA PROTOCOL FOR TACTICAL APPLICATIONS
    ABEL, RJ
    DINSCHEL, DE
    WANG, PSS
    [J]. 1989 IEEE MILITARY COMMUNICATIONS CONFERENCE, VOLS 1-3: BRIDGING THE GAP : INTEROPERABILITY, SURVIVABILITY, SECURITY, 1989, : 53 - 69
  • [8] A data collection protocol for real-time sensor applications
    Paradis, Lilia
    Han, Qi
    [J]. PERVASIVE AND MOBILE COMPUTING, 2009, 5 (04) : 369 - 384
  • [9] MAINTAINING CONSISTENCY OVER A NETWORK IN REAL-TIME APPLICATIONS
    LEE, IS
    DAVIDSON, S
    WOLFE, V
    [J]. PROCEEDINGS OF THE 1989 AMERICAN CONTROL CONFERENCE, VOLS 1-3, 1989, : 528 - 533
  • [10] Partitioning Real-Time Applications Over Multicore Reservations
    Buttazzo, Giorgio
    Bini, Enrico
    Wu, Yifan
    [J]. IEEE TRANSACTIONS ON INDUSTRIAL INFORMATICS, 2011, 7 (02) : 302 - 315